Two of Southport’s most-loved local businesses have been shortlisted as Hidden Gems in this year’s Liverpool City Tourism Awards! 

Season Coffee, Bar and Kitchen, on King Street and Tik Taco on Coronation Walk, both in Southport town centre, are among 10 venues from across the Liverpool City Region which have been honoured. 

In Sefton, The Lake House in Waterloo has also been included in the top 10.

Over the last month the public have been nominating their favourite Hidden Gems.

The Hidden Gem category at the Liverpool City Region Tourism Awards celebrates the region’s best kept secrets and puts them in the tourism spotlight. 

Gems may be attractions, bars, restaurants, tours, or natural assets which are off the main tourism trail.

The winner will be revealed at the awards ceremony at Liverpool Cathedral on Thursday 29th February 2024.

Janet Nuzum, Sector Manager Visitor Economy at Growth Platform – Liverpool City Region Growth Company, who organise the awards, said, 

“The Hidden Gem category is the only category in the Tourism Awards which is voted for by the general public and we are delighted that this year we received a record number of votes with over 100 businesses nominated in this initial round. This demonstrates the breadth of truly fantastic tourism hidden gems we have across the Liverpool City Region.”

The Hidden Gem finalists are:

Season Coffee, Bar & Kitchen, Southport 

A cosy, relaxed venue offering a range of food and drink that uses only produce from other local independent businesses in Southport.

Tik Taco, Southport

A cantina serving locally sourced fresh, vibrant authentic Mexican food in Southport.

Gin Journey

A tour to discover Liverpool’s rich past, with a delicious drink in your hand to bring it all to life.

Glass Onion

Veggie/vegan café serving delicious fresh homemade food and cakes in Allerton.

Hop/Scotch

An independent whisky bar tucked away down an unassuming staircase in Liverpool’s Fabric District.

Lake House Waterloo

A stunning restaurant serving delicious, locally sourced menus at the water’s edge of the marine lake in Crosby.

Red Brick Market

An independent Market in Liverpool’s Baltic district with over 50 businesses under one roof.

Reel Tours

Walking tour in which you will visit many prominent film locations that have made the city so synonymous with moviegoers worldwide.

The Bus Yard

Two converted double decker buses operating in Crosby Marina, Liverpool ONE Chavasse Park and other pop-up locations.

The Danny

An Art Deco steamship, rescued by the passion and skill of a volunteer force who run the project and operate the vessel today.
